Description Doxazosin is an alpha-1 antagonist used for the treatment of benign prostatic hypertrophy (BPH) symptoms and hypertension. Other members of this drug class include [Prazosin], [Terazosin], [Tamsulosin], and [Alfuzosin].[A180661] Because of its long-lasting effects, doxazosin can be administered once a day.[A180649] It is marketed by Pfizer and was initially approved by the FDA in 1990.[L7285]
Indications and Usage For treatment and management of mild to moderate hypertension and urinary obstruction symptoms caused by BPH.
